Clay County (MS) Oktibbeha County (MS)
Population estimates, July 1, 2019, (V2019) 19,386 49,599
Population, percent change - April 1, 2010 (estimates base) to July 1, 2019, (V2019) -6.0% 4.0%
Population estimates base, April 1, 2010, (V2019) 20,634 47,671
Population, Census, April 1, 2010 20,634 47,671
Persons under 5 years, percent 5.6% 5.4%
Persons under 18 years, percent 22.6% 17.8%
Persons 65 years and over, percent 18.5% 11.5%
Female persons, percent 53.2% 50.1%
White alone, percent 39.7% 57.8%
Black or African American alone, percent 58.9% 37.6%
American Indian and Alaska Native alone, percent 0.3% 0.2%
Asian alone, percent 0.3% 3.1%
Two or More Races, percent 0.8% 1.2%
Hispanic or Latino, percent 1.6% 1.7%
White alone, not Hispanic or Latino, percent 38.7% 56.6%
Veterans, 2014-2018 1,102 1,655
Foreign born persons, percent, 2014-2018 0.3% 3.6%
Housing units, July 1, 2018, (V2018) 9,304 22,201
Owner-occupied housing unit rate, 2014-2018 71.2% 50.9%
Median value of owner-occupied housing units, 2014-2018 $87,400 $161,100
Median selected monthly owner costs -with a mortgage, 2014-2018 $956 $1,283
Median selected monthly owner costs -without a mortgage, 2014-2018 $364 $393
Median gross rent, 2014-2018 $750 $789
Housing units in multi-unit structures, percent, 2009-2013 12.1% 34.4%
Building permits, 2018 16 119
Households, 2014-2018 7,755 17,687
Persons per household, 2014-2018 2.52 2.50
Living in same house 1 year ago, percent of persons age 1 year+, 2014-2018 90.0% 75.1%
Language other than English spoken at home, percent of persons age 5 years+, 2014-2018 1.1% 5.0%
Households with a computer, percent, 2014-2018 77.0% 86.8%
Households with a broadband Internet subscription, percent, 2014-2018 66.7% 73.4%
High school graduate or higher, percent of persons age 25 years+, 2014-2018 81.6% 90.5%
Bachelor's degree or higher, percent of persons age 25 years+, 2014-2018 20.1% 43.5%
With a disability, under age 65 years, percent, 2014-2018 6.8% 8.4%
Persons without health insurance, under age 65 years, percent 14.8% 15.6%
In civilian labor force, total, percent of population age 16 years+, 2014-2018 53.8% 55.5%
In civilian labor force, female, percent of population age 16 years+, 2014-2018 48.7% 51.7%
Total accommodation and food services sales, 2012 ($1,000) 22,617 125,240
Total health care and social assistance receipts/revenue, 2012 ($1,000) 62,171 158,010
Total manufacturers shipments, 2012 ($1,000) 656,561 569,081
Total merchant wholesaler sales, 2012 ($1,000) 158,429 187,298
Total retail sales, 2012 ($1,000) 165,403 471,973
Total retail sales per capita, 2012 $8,097 $9,794
Mean travel time to work (minutes), workers age 16 years+, 2014-2018 22.1 18.6
Median household income (in 2018 dollars), 2014-2018 $35,121 $38,800
Per capita income in past 12 months (in 2018 dollars), 2014-2018 $21,076 $22,136
Persons in poverty, percent 21.9% 27.3%
Total employer establishments, 2017 353 889
Total employment, 2017 4,435 12,560
Total annual payroll, 2017 ($1,000) 158,681 367,702
Total employment, percent change, 2016-2017 2.2% -2.1%
Total nonemployer establishments, 2017 1,279 3,138
All firms, 2012 1,508 3,449
Men-owned firms, 2012 736 1,786
Women-owned firms, 2012 638 1,313
Minority-owned firms, 2012 643 1,269
Nonminority-owned firms, 2012 779 2,007
Veteran-owned firms, 2012 181 486
Nonveteran-owned firms, 2012 1,237 2,779
Black-owned firms, percent, 2007 0.0% 0.0%
American Indian- and Alaska Native-owned firms, percent, 2007 0.0% 0.0%
Asian-owned firms, percent, 2007 0.0% 2.1%
Native Hawaiian- and Other Pacific Islander-owned firms, percent, 2007 0.0% 0.0%
Hispanic-owned firms, percent, 2007 0.0% 1.1%
Women-owned firms, percent, 2007 25.2% 22.5%
Population per square mile, 2010 50.3 104.0
Land area in square miles, 2010 410.08 458.20
Source: United States Census Bureau
About this page: Side-by-side comparison between Clay county (MS) and Oktibbeha county (MS) using the main population, demographic, and social indicators from the United States Census Bureau.
